The global Portable Neurofeedback Device Market, valued at US$ 156 million in 2024, is poised for substantial growth, projected to reach US$ 289 million by 2032. This expansion, representing a compound annual growth rate (CAGR) of 9.2%, is detailed in a comprehensive new report published by Semiconductor Insight. The study underscores the transformative role of these advanced brain-training devices in mental wellness, cognitive enhancement, and therapeutic applications across diverse sectors.

Portable neurofeedback devices, which enable real-time monitoring and training of brain activity through electroencephalography (EEG) and other biosensing technologies, are becoming essential tools for both clinical professionals and individual consumers. Their non-invasive nature and user-friendly designs allow for effective self-regulation of brain functions, making them increasingly popular for managing conditions like ADHD, anxiety, and sleep disorders while also supporting peak mental performance in healthy individuals.

Mental Health Awareness and Technological Accessibility: The Primary Growth Drivers

The report identifies the global surge in mental health awareness and the democratization of neurotechnology as the paramount drivers for portable neurofeedback device adoption. With mental health applications accounting for approximately 65% of device usage, the correlation between rising global mental health concerns and market growth is direct and substantial. The global mental health apps market itself is projected to exceed $26 billion by 2027, creating substantial demand for complementary hardware solutions.

"The significant concentration of tech-savvy consumers and mental health professionals in North America and Europe, which collectively consume about 70% of global portable neurofeedback devices, is a crucial factor in the market's momentum," the report states. With global investments in digital health technologies exceeding $57 billion in 2023 alone, the demand for accessible brain training solutions is accelerating, particularly as stigma around mental health treatment decreases and preventive care gains prominence.

Emerging Opportunities in Corporate Wellness and Educational Sectors

Beyond traditional healthcare applications, the report outlines significant emerging opportunities in corporate wellness programs and educational institutions. The growing emphasis on employee mental health and cognitive performance in workplace settings presents new avenues for device adoption, with major corporations increasingly incorporating neurofeedback into their wellness offerings. Similarly, educational institutions are exploring these technologies for enhancing student focus and learning capabilities, particularly in special education settings.

Furthermore, the integration of virtual reality with neurofeedback represents a cutting-edge trend. Combined VR-neurofeedback systems can create immersive training environments that enhance engagement and effectiveness, particularly for anxiety treatment and peak performance training. The development of cloud-based platforms enabling remote supervision by healthcare professionals is also expanding access to professional-grade neurofeedback beyond clinical settings.

Emerging Opportunities in Automotive Radar and Satellite Communications

Beyond the 5G boom, the report outlines significant emerging opportunities. The rapid adoption of automotive radar systems for ADAS and autonomous driving functions presents a robust growth avenue, requiring capacitors that perform reliably in harsh automotive environments. Furthermore, the expansion of low-earth orbit (LEO) satellite constellations for global broadband is creating new demand for space-grade RF components capable of withstanding radiation and extreme temperatures.
